
Team Smile, a students' initiative to reach out to underprivileged children at Central University of South Bihar's Gaya campus, held a certificate-distribution ceremony on May 18 to acknowledge contributions of its active members.
Public relations officer Mohammad Mudassir Alam said the event was held under the supervision of Pranav Kumar, faculty supervisor, Team Smile, and assistant professor of political studies.
He said the objective was to acknowledge and appreciate students who were regular in visiting government schools and always put a step forward in organising events. Starting off the programme was Badri Sankar Das, newly elected president of Team Smile. He was followed by Aman Sagar, who gave a short introduction about the evolution of Team Smile and what it does. Then, certificates were distributed to the students.
Farewell for girls
Final-year zoology students of JD Women's College bade farewell at a ceremony organised for them by the second-year students on May 15. The function started with welcome songs, as the guests of honour danced.
The outgoing students reminisced how the past three years were for them - what a nice experience it was on campus and how cooperative and helpful were the teachers.
The second-year students presented dance acts and plays. Ankita Sharma, one of the outgoing students, said: "It was a pleasant and happy moment to study at a college where not only are your skills sharpened but also every one is disciplined."
